I'm looking for ancestral information on Ed Akers who lived in Charlton,
MA. He is my gggrandfather, and here's what I know about him: b. 9-16-1829
m. Melina Parsons 1-1-1852 in Palmer, MA d. 8-5-1908 Charlton, MA. He owned
the Akers & Taylor mill in the 1800s and lived with his wife in a large
home on Stafford St. in Charlton, at the corner of what used to be the main
highway into Worcester in those days. The house still stands today, but
is in ill repair, having descended to one of his gggrand children, Richard
Taylor, who is my 1st cousin.. Ed had two daughters: Grace, who married
Harry Grimwade, and Edith who married Frederick Taylor. Harry and Grace
lived in Charlton and were very prominent and well-to-do, as were the Taylors.
In 1903, Grace died suddenly and unexpectedly from heart failure at the
age of 33. I have her Charlton obituary. She left two small children: Roger
(4) and Muriel (10 months). .Ed and his son-in-law partner Frederick Taylor
died within two months of each other in 1908, after which the mills went
to Ed's surviving son-in-law, Harry Grimwade. Ed's wife Melina continued
to live in the Stafford St. house until her death in 1917, at which time
Fred Taylor's son, Ralph (my grandfather), took up residence there. Ultimately
Ralph became the owner after Edith Akers died in 1942. The house later passed
to Ralph's son Richard when Edith Collins Taylor died as a widow in 1973.
Richard lived in the house until his death in 1986, at which time the house
went to his four children, Richard "Dickie", Marsha, Holly and
Jenny. To my knowledge, they still own the house. Ed Aker's father was Henry
